Bahria Foundation School Sagri

Bahria, Foundation School Sagri or BFSS is located in Sagri, Rawalpindi, Punjab, Pakistan. The school is a subsidiary of Pakistan Navy and was launched on April 4, 2016 by Bahria Foundation. The school is located near Sagri stop, Rawat- Kallar Syedan Road, Tehsil Rawalpindi.
Introduction
Initially , the school offers admission in Montessori Section up to grade 7. Currently, a total of 300 plus students have been enrolled and imparted education on modern lines aligned with their social, cultural and religious norms. It has co- education at all levels. Normally, the academic sessions begin in the month of April every year . Registration and admission for all classes begin in January which continue till the mid of March.

Facilities
The school provides physical training facilities to the students by offering different sports like Basket Ball, Table Tennis, Badminton and Cricket.
The school has a library and well built computer lab and Science lab. It also has huge activity hall equipped with Montessori apparatus .
